s:The maximum vibration amplitudes of cylinders at upstream and downstream are raised to a larger extent in comparison with single cylinder. The mean resistance against the downstream cylinder is smaller than that of the upstream cylinder, while the root-mean-square (r.m.s) of lift force against the downstream cylinder is smaller than that of the upstream cylinder in case ofUr6.1 but larger in case of6.1rU. In addition, two wake-stream patterns are summarized, i.e. single resistance fluid pattern (SG) and shear-layer attached pattern (AG).关键词
